Germany is a non-nuclear state under the Nuclear Non-Proliferation Treaty (NPT).
However, Germany participates in NATO’s nuclear sharing program, and is believed to host around 20 American B61 tactical nuclear bombs at the Buechel Air Base in Rhineland-Palatinate. This number represents a fraction of the 3,500 American nuclear bombs and missiles deployed in West Germany during the Cold War, which included Pershing II intermediate-range ballistic missiles and multiple kinds of nuclear artillery. The presence of American nuclear weapons on German soil was highly controversial. Millions protested the deployment of the Pershing II missiles in 1983. Nevertheless, the deployment was supported by Social Democrat Chancellor Helmut Schmidt and carried out under his successor, Helmut Kohl, a member of current Chancellor Friedrich Merz’ Christian Democrats. Is Germany seeking nuclear weapons? There is no indication that Germany plans to produce fissile material, which would violate its NPT obligations. However, Merz has recently suggested that he plans on expanding Germany’s involvement with nuclear weapons beyond the confines of NATO.
